A prominent health organization in Manchester is seeking a Pelvic Health Physiotherapist to manage both Urogynaecology and Obstetric cases. The role includes delivery of evidence-based physiotherapy, supervising less experienced staff, and participating in service development projects. Candidates should have prior experience in pelvic health and strong interpersonal skills. Support for professional development is provided in a collaborative environment. Weekend support is also expected. Join a team dedicated to clinical excellence and innovation.
The post holder will be based within the Rehabilitation Unit at St Mary's Hospital and will include both in‑ and out‑patient work across maternity and gynaecology. Applicants are required to have previous pelvic health experience and aim to advance these skills with support. This post offers excellent facilities and support for continued professional development. The successful applicant can be assured of supervision, training and development within a supportive team, as well as opportunities to develop research ideas and attend academic and clinical meetings. It is an ideal opportunity for anyone wishing to develop their pelvic health clinical skills whilst being able to contribute to clinical effectiveness within the Trust. A flexible attitude and excellent interpersonal and team‑working skills are essential. The post holder will be expected to support weekend working as part of the role.
The service accepts referrals from acute, primary and secondary care providers.
